Whilst visiting Scotland to Climb Ben Nevis with my 11 year old son, I thought it would be a great surprise to take him for an Ice Climbing taster session, which I had kept a surprise until we walked into the reception at The Ice Factor.
His face lit up when he found out and saw what he was about to do.
Without delay he was kitted up and on the ice with instructor Mike.
The ice walls are very impressive being at different angles and arrangements in order to give differing levels of difficulty.
After a few initial shaky moments at the start and with great instruction from mike he was up and climbing, with crampons and ice picks in minutes.
By the end of the one hour session he had climbed the easy wall then a corner wall an almost vertical wall and an overhang. The walls go up to about 50 feet high and within the first 1/2 hour my son had been to the top for the first time and did three or more ascents as high as you can go, all the time safely belayed by Mike.
I don't know if we were just fortunate, but he had a full one to one for an hour.
Great value for money.
All we had to provide were warm clothes and gloves.

Was up in the Highlands with my teenage lad on a Boys Own road trip - camping, biking, sailing, boozing, driving my M6, and while we were camping in Kinlochleven, I remembered a female friend of mine mentioning The Ice Factor. Tent pitched, we set off and booked ourselves a session. The Tailrace Inn beckoned but we thought it prudent to stick to Cokes until after the climb. Good job we did too. Boy it was tough. I used to free climb a very long time ago but this was something completely different. Tendon testing in the extreme, But extremely safe. Your climbing partner will be roughly the same weight as you, and you take turns belaying each other up the climb. If I remember correctly, there were three different climbs, each longer and tougher than the rest. The trick is to spike in with the scary ice boots and push up, rather than haul with the ice axe. God! I was knackered at the end, strapping teenage son likewise. But it was pure deid brilliant. And the pint in the Tailrace Inn afterwards hissed all the way down. Highly recommended if you're up in the northern part of God's Country and looking for something a wee bit different... And challenging.
